Does Marijuana Combat HIV and AIDS?

Marijuana can do more for AIDS patients than simply help them with their nausea or loss of appetite, according to a new study. New research published in the medical journal PLoS One suggests marijuana-like compounds actually fight the HIV virus in late-stage AIDS patients. Researchers they already know “cannabinoid drugs” like marijuana can have a therapeutic effect in AIDS patients.
